KALAMAZOO, MI (WKZO AM/FM) – A Kalamazoo couple are facing involuntary manslaughter charges in the death of their six-month-old daughter in December 2023.
Kalamazoo County Prosecutor Jeff Getting says 40-year-old Jose Roldan Jr. and 29-year-old Ladesha Powe admitted to smoking marijuana and drinking heavily before they fell asleep on the couch with their baby girl on December 12.
Getting says video from a living room camera shows the little girl kicking and crying as she was wedged between her father and the couch.
When Roldan woke up around 8 a.m. on December 13, he noticed their daughter stuck between the seat and the back cushion and was not breathing. Powe was holding the baby when she fell asleep, and the little girl fell from her arms and got wedged between her 300-pound father and the couch.
